>     Hi everybody,
>
>  I am new to python  and I am discovering it.
>  I know C well,
>  and want to know if python knows how to manage Pointers
>  like pointer to function  here is a C example how to write it in python
>  Intergration with trapeze method
>
>  When we write Trapeze   ( at the compilation level) we don't know which
> functions
>  Fonc  to handle.      Here for example we use  sin and a user defined  F1
>  The program is attached too
>
>     #include <stdio.h>
> #include <math.h>
>
> double F1 (double x){
>         return x*x;
> }
> double Trapeze(double Fonc(double ),
>                                 double left, double right, double step){
>   double X1, X0, Y0, Y1, Z = 0;
>   for(X0=left; X0 < right ; X0 = X0 + step) {
>     X1 = X0 + step;
>     Y1 = Fonc(X1);    Y0 = Fonc(X0);
>     Z  += (Y1 + Y0) * step * 0.5;
>   }
>    return Z;
> }
> int  main(){
>   double y;
>   y=Trapeze(sin, -2.5, 3.2, 0.1);
>   printf("\n\tValue for sin  is : \t %8.3lf ", y);
>   y=Trapeze(F1, 0, 3, 0.1);
>   printf("\n\tValue for F1 is : \t %8.3lf ", y);
>   return 0;
> }
> /**
>     Value for sin  is :         0.197
>     Value for F1 is :          9.005
>     */
